Best Business Casual Shoe Selections for Professionals
Navigating the world of business casual footwear can be a tricky endeavor. You want to appear polished, yet still feel comfortable throughout your workday. Fortunately, there are a variety of stylish and practical options that strike the perfect balance.
Leather oxfords remain a classic choice, offering a timeless look that's versatile enough for meetings and presentations. For a more casual feel, consider loafers or monk straps. These shoes can be easily dressed up. Don't ignore the power of a well-chosen pair of boots, either. Chelsea or chukka boots can add a touch of individuality while still maintaining a professional aesthetic.
Remember to choose shoes that fit your personal style. When in doubt, opt for neutral colors like black, brown, or navy. Avoid overly flashy designs or bright shades. Ultimately, the best business casual shoes are those that make you feel confident and ready to take on the day.
Business Casual: A Guide to Modern Workplace Attire
The modern workplace has witnessed a shift towards more relaxed dress codes, with business casual becoming the prevailing standard in many industries. This versatile style strikes a balance between professional and comfortable attire, allowing employees to express their individuality while maintaining a polished appearance.
To successfully navigate the nuances of business casual, it's essential to understand its key components. Opt for well-fitted garments in fabrics such as cotton, linen, or wool blends. steer clear of overly casual items like t-shirts, jeans (unless specifically permitted), and athletic wear.
Consider incorporating a variety of classic pieces into your business casual wardrobe, such as dress pants, button-down shirts, blouses, blazers, and sweaters. Accessorize your outfits with subtle jewelry and belts to add a touch of personality.
- Remember that specific industry guidelines and company policies may influence the level of formality required for business casual attire.
- When in doubt, it's always best to err on the side of respectability.
Ultimately, mastering business casual is about striking a harmonious balance between style and professionalism. By following these guidelines, you can confidently navigate the modern workplace while making a lasting impression.

Key Components of a Polished Business Professional Wardrobe
A curated wardrobe is vital for making a positive statement in the professional world. To cultivate a polished and presentable appearance, consider these core elements:
- Well-tailored Suits in Neutral Tones: Opt for timeless fabrics like wool or silk.
- Clean Shirts and Blouses: Choose fabrics that are both comfortable, and consider incorporating subtle details for added elegance.
- Modest Footwear: Oxfords in black or brown leather are always a smart choice.
- Elegant Accessories: A tasteful watch, belt, and structured handbag can complete your look.
